SQream, a well-funded Israel-based data analytics platform, has announced that it has acquired no-code data platform Panoply in an effort to expand its cloud services.
The two platforms are quite complementary, with Panoply providing SQream with the tools and expertise to expand its platform to a wider user base.
Panoply will continue to operate as a separate business unit, but as Panoply co-founder and CEO Yaniv Leven notes in today’s announcement, the acquisition means that the 160+ strong team will now have access to additional resources and expertise. SQream says it has “ambition growth plans” for the service in order to meet demand for the platform’s services.
